Planning commission approves auto-sales special use at 4314 East Broadway after neighbors raise noise, cleanup concerns

Summary

The North Little Rock Planning Commission approved a special use permit allowing a small auto-sales display at 4314 East Broadway after neighbors voiced concerns about past trash, noise and yard maintenance. Commissioners attached standard conditions; the applicant must still appear before City Council.

The North Little Rock Planning Commission voted to approve a special-use permit allowing auto sales at 4314 East Broadway, despite neighbors who urged the commission to deny the request because of past trash, noise and yard-maintenance problems.

The vote came after applicant Jaden Brown told commissioners he currently uses the property as an office and said he did not display cars or operate loud equipment. "I solely use it as an office space," Brown said, adding that he has been mowing the lot regularly and has installed security cameras.
